Output f28b6cd24b4e2b70331fa0a98ce00923ac3f4c9abd4eb2dc6c8d844a905c4c4d:129

value
132400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e36857096b1dd9bb953e762c1ae09bb40d229f OP_EQUAL
address
3BtdMPiUpLcNAtBvhCt2NjL5SbPyWMggXJ
transaction
f28b6cd24b4e2b70331fa0a98ce00923ac3f4c9abd4eb2dc6c8d844a905c4c4d
confirmations
196325
spent
true